Интернет-магазин: этапы от идеи до запуска
Путь к успешному интернет-магазину начинается с четкого видения целей, целевой аудитории и ассортимента. Сформулируйте ценностное предложение, проанализируйте конкурентов и зафиксируйте метрики успеха — разработка интернет магазина начинается именно с этого. Краткий бизнес-план удерживает проект в пределах бюджета.
Анализ требований
Соберите список функциональных модулей: каталог, многоуровневая корзина, кабинет клиента, платежи, логистика, маркетинговые инструменты. Определите интеграции с ERP, CRM и системами учёта налогов. На этом этапе выявляются зависимости, оцениваются сроки и ресурсы.

Технологическая основа формирует будущую гибкость. SaaS-решения сокращают время выхода на рынок, однако ограничивают кастомизацию. Самостоятельная платформа на open-source требует DevOps-компетенций, но дарит контроль над кодом и инфраструктурой. Сравните совокупную стоимость владения, безопасность, экосистему расширений.
Выбор платформы
При выборе учитывайте масштабируемость, владение данными, лицензионные сборы, дружелюбие к разработчикам и частоту обновлений. Magento, Shopware, Shopify, WooCommerce и российские SaaS удовлетворяют разным сценариям. Для высокого трафика подойдёт микросервисная архитектура с Headless CMS.
Прототип представления товара ускоряет решение UX-задач. Создайте интерактивный макет, показывающий путь клиента от карточки товара до подтверждения платежа. Привлеките UX-исследователя для юзабилити-тестов на ранней стадии.
Дизайн и контент
UI оформляется в стиле продукта: типографика, цветовая палитра, анимация. Контрастные элементы навигации повышают конверсию, крупные кнопки упрощают использование мобильного экрана. Изображения оптимизируются для WebP, описания пишутся по модели AIDA и включают microcopy для поля ввода.
Верстка строится на Mobile-first, адаптивные сетки спроектированы под кратные 4 pt шаги, SVG-иконки сокращают время загрузки. Доступность WCAG 2.1 соблюдается: alt-тексты, фокус в клавиатурной навигации, достаточный контраст.
При разработке Backend используйте многоуровневое кеширование: CDN, Varnish, Redis. REST или GraphQL API отделяет фронт от логики, упрощая интеграции с мобильным приложением и маркетплейсами. Unit-тесты и Code Review снижают риск регрессий.
Платежный процессор выбирайте с учётом фискальных регуляций. Интегрируйте Apple Pay, Google Pay, карты «Мир», крипто-шлюзы, когда стратегия предусматривает. Для логистики подключайте мульти-карьерные сервисы, поддерживающие расчет стоимости доставки в реальном времени.
Системы email-маркетинга, Push-уведомления, ретаргетинговые пиксели подключаются через Webhooks. Для соблюдения GDPR и 152-ФЗ настройте согласие на cookies и хранение персональных данных в шифрованном виде.
Перед релизом выполните нагрузочное тестирование: сценарии пикового трафика, стресс до отказа, долгосрочный soak. Проверьте резервы по CPU, RAM, IOPS. Security-сканеры SAST и DAST выявляют уязвимости, включая SQL-инъекции, XSS, CSRF.
Миграция DNS планируется на период низкого трафика. Канары или Blue-Green исключают длительные простои. Мониторинг Prometheus и Grafana фиксирует метрики. Канал оповещений в Slack реагирует на аномалии.
После запуска анализируйте когортную ретенцию, средний чек, LTV, CPA. A/B-эксперименты оптимизируют контент и оформление checkout. Roadmap дополняется функциями подписки, накопительных бонусов, омниканального обслуживания.
Регулярные обновления закрывают уязвимости, снижают технический долг, повышают совместимость с внешними сервисами. Документация в Confluence и автоматизированные пайплайны CI/CD держат процесс прозрачным для команды.
Интернет-торговля укрепилась как ключевой канал продаж для компаний любого калибра. Ниже изложен целостный алгоритм, охватывающий каждую фазу запуска магазина — от планирования до поискового продвижения.
Определение платформы
Команда фиксирует бизнес-требования: объём каталога, интеграции со складом, архитектуру скидок, нагрузку в пиках. Затем сопоставляет их с функционалом доступных решений. Для компактного старта выбирают SaaS: Shopify, Ecwid, Kaspi, Tilda. При ожидании сотен тысяч SKU рассматривают Magento, Shopware, «Битрикс: Управление сайтом». Индивидуальная разработка оправдана при сложной логистике или мультибрендовой франшизе.
При выборе хостинга берут во внимание географию посетителей, платёжный метод и требования регуляторов к персональным данным. Облако с автоскейлингом страхует от перегрузок в сезонных распродажах, выделенный сервер нужен при строгой политике хранения данных.
Юзабилити и дизайн
Конверсия зависит от скорости нахождения товара. Категории располагаются в шапке, фильтры — слева или каскадом под баннером. Поиск с подсказками выводит артикул, фото, цену. В карточке акцент на кнопку «Добавить в корзину», дополнительные детали спрятаны в аккордеонах для компактности.
Цветовая палитра отражает позиционирование бренда, а контраст подчёркивает действия. Верстка адаптивная: минимальный размер интерактивных элементов — 44 × 44 px, текст читабелен при 320 px по ширине. Покупатель проходит путь от первого клика до оплаты не больше чем за три шага, этапы подписаны, ошибки отображаются без перезагрузки.
Маркетинг и SEO
Ассортимент индексируется поисковыми системами после генерации человекочитаемых URL, заголовков h1 и мета-описаний длиной до 155 символов. Изображения снабжаются альтернативным текстом с ключевым запросом. Страницы пагинации получают rel=»next» и rel=»prev» для сохранения веса.
Карта сайта в формате XML обновляется автоматически при добавлении товара. Файл robots.txt закрывает технические директории. Для структурированных данных внедряется схема Product, Review, Breadcrumb. Такая микроразметка формирует расширенные сниппеты и повышает CTR.
Скорость загрузки ускоряется благодаря WebP, lazy-loading, критическому CSS и подключениям через HTTP/2. Core Web Vitals контролируются Lighthouse, LCP удерживается ниже 2,5 с, CLS — под 0,1. Кэш на стороне браузера выставляется до 30 дней, а сервер подаёт gzip или brotli.
CRM фиксирует источники трафика, средний чек, повторные заказы. Данные передаются в BI-систему для прогнозирования ассортимента и выявления сезонных колебаний. Из увиденных паттернов формируются персонализированные рассылки и рекомендации в карточках товара.
Подробная методика, изложенная выше, служит каркасом для долговременного роста. При цикличной проверке метрик интерфейс, каталог, логистика и продвижение эволюционируют синхронно с целями бизнеса.